Orpheum Theater
The Orpheum Theater in St. Louis, Missouri, is a Beaux Arts-style theater built in 1917. It was constructed by local self-made millionaire Louis A. Cella and designed by architect Albert Lansburgh.Photo: Marcus Qwertyus, CC BY-SA 3.0.

- Type: Historic building
- Description: theater in St. Louis, Missouri, United States
- Also known as: “American Theater”, “Loew’s Orpheum Theater”, “Roberts Orphem Theater”, and “Roberts Orpheum Theater”
- Address: 416 North 9th Street, Saint Louis, MO 63101

The Magnolia Hotel St. Louis is a historic hotel in downtown St. Louis, Missouri. Opened in 1925, it has been known for most of its existence as the Mayfair Hotel.

Columbus Square is a neighborhood of St. Louis, Missouri. It is bounded by Cass Avenue to the north, I-70 to the east, Tucker & North 13th Streets to the west, and Cole Street to the south.

Downtown West is a neighborhood in St. Louis, Missouri. It is, as the name suggests, a section of downtown that is further inland, west from the banks of the Mississippi River.
